Review: Capriccio/Lyric Opera of Chicago by Zach Freeman

RECOMMENDED Loaded with the star power of soprano Renée Fleming, propelled by music director and conductor Sir Andrew Davis' unique understanding of the score, and set in the 1920's framework of John Cox's controversial production, Lyric Opera of Chicago's revisitation of Richard Strauss' "conversation piece" "Capriccio" must be considered in light of its weight as […]
